BANKING AmSouth Bank has opened a branch office at 614 S Dale Mabry Highway, Palma Ceia, its 34th branch to open in Hillsborough County. CONSTRUCTION Caladesi Construction Co., 1390 Donegan Road, Largo, announces these contracts: Southwest Florida Water Management District, 3,750 square feet, project building No. 4 expansion, 7601 U.S. 301 N, $200,000; and Houle Industries, 21,000-square-foot, new roof at 530 Commerce Drive, Largo, $100,000. The Bath & Kitchen Gallery, 6406 E Fowler Ave., Tampa, announces the launch of its Web site, www.TampaKitchenand Bath.com. The Web site features remodeling articles and an online monthly newsletter that provides home-remodeling tips. ENGINEERING PBS&J, 5300 W Cypress St., Suite 200, Tampa, announces the formation of its Applied Technologies Group service line. ATG is designed to align the technological needs of its clients and the engineering marketplace. INTERIOR DESIGN Contract Interior Services Inc., 13098 Gulf Blvd., Suite B, Madeira Beach, announces its contract for project management services, all interior specifications, buying of furnishings and finish materials for a 4,000-square-foot outpatient clinic in Plattsburgh, N.Y., for the Veterans Administration, $65,000. MISCELLANEOUS The city of Pinellas Park and the Pinellas Park/Mid-County Chamber of Commerce announce the winners of the 2007 Business of Distinction Awards: Astro Skating Center, 10001 66th St. N; Joe's Towing & Recovery Inc., 6670 114th Ave.; Let the Good Times Roll, 10707 66th St. N, Suite 15; Optek, 6825 38th St.; Schneller Inc., 6200 49th St.; and Victor Distributing Co., 11125 49th St. The winners were businesses that have expanded staff, facilities or operations, improved facilities through design or landscaping, participated in the community, created an innovative marketing campaign or product and provided exceptional customer service. REAL ESTATE Ciminelli Real Estate Services, 3928 Premier North Drive, Tampa, announces that Liberty Mutual Insurance Co. has signed a five-year lease extension for 39,772 square feet of office space at the Premier Corporate Center office park, Tampa. Cushman and Wakefield of Florida Inc., One Tampa City Center, Suite 3600, Tampa, announces these lease transactions: Crescent Resources LLC to Gerdau Ameristeel, 5,344 square feet, office space, expansion lease, 4221 W Boy Scout Blvd., Tampa; and Riverview NI Industrial LLC, c/o CAM-NIP, to Media General Operations Inc., 16,200 square feet, class A office space, lease renewal, First Park at Brandon, 2720 S Falkenburg Road, Riverview. RECRUITMENT Gevity, 9000 Town Center Parkway, Bradenton, has opened an office in the Canadian province of Ontario. Gevity is an employee management solution provider to small and mid-sized businesses. RESTAURANT Cherry's South Tampa, 3114 W Bay-to-Bay Blvd., Tampa, announces it has changed its name to Hawk's Neighborhood Grill. TECHNOLOGY Market Technologies, 5807 Old Pasco Road, Wesley Chapel, announces the rerelease of VantagePoint Intermarket Analysis Software version 7.0.
